
CosmosRider
@contortg8
0 reply
0 recast
0 reaction
0 reply
0 recast
0 reaction
0 reply
0 recast
0 reaction
Hey folks, the World Happiness Report 2025 ranks the happiest nations: Finland, Denmark, Iceland, Sweden, Netherlands, Costa Rica, Norway, Israel, Luxembourg, and Mexico. Big shoutout to Costa Rica and Mexico being in the top 10! 0 reply
0 recast
0 reaction
0 reply
0 recast
0 reaction
0 reply
0 recast
0 reaction
12 replies
2 recasts
55 reactions
7 replies
10 recasts
76 reactions
9 replies
5 recasts
42 reactions
6 replies
3 recasts
26 reactions
9 replies
12 recasts
28 reactions
0 reply
0 recast
0 reaction
13 replies
6 recasts
55 reactions
13 replies
13 recasts
48 reactions
5 replies
2 recasts
34 reactions
0 reply
0 recast
0 reaction
12 replies
3 recasts
39 reactions
7 replies
0 recast
19 reactions
31 replies
4 recasts
46 reactions
0 reply
0 recast
0 reaction